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center is a patient care, teaching and research affiliate of Harvard Medical School and consistently ranks as a national leader among independent hospitals in National Institutes of Health funding. BIDMC is the official hospital of the Boston Red Sox.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center is a part of Beth Israel Lahey Health, a health care system that brings together academic medical centers and teaching hospitals, community and specialty hospitals, more than 4,800 physicians and 36,000 employees in a shared mission to expand access to great care and advance the science and practice of medicine through groundbreaking research and education.

Established in 1922 and headquartered in Tampa, Florida, Shriners Hospital is a non-profit organization that specializes in providing healthcare services for children that suffer from spinal cord injuries, burns, and other ailments.

Connecticut Children's Medical Center, founded in 1996 and headquartered in Hartford, Connecticut, operates as a non-profit organization. The Hospital offers surgery, pediatric trauma, and primary care services.

Columbus Community Hospital is a 40-bed, acute care medical and surgical facility recognized throughout the community as a comprehensive health care organization. The Hospital is located in Columbus, Nebraska.
